We wanted to frontload the video clip with as much details and brand name individuality as possible. We wanted to be as fast and concise as possible in the video script.


We sure did! Next off up in the video clip production procedure: scripting. We extremely recommend utilizing Google Docs to script your video. It's simply the very best tool for teaming up in real time with your innovative partners or stakeholders, whether you're in the very same area or otherwise. A well-crafted manuscript establishes the tone for your video clip.

It's likewise vital to concentrate on scene configuration and breakdown, correct lights, and premium sound.


Right here's a manufacturing checklist for you: Design the set for every scene. Select all the props you need. Frame each shot meticulously to record the preferred feel use this link and look. Block each fired with your talent to identify their activity and positioning. Set up and damage down each shot effectively. Guarantee appropriate lights for both the scene and skill.

Record several takes with a supervisor leading your skill. Ensure you have sufficient protection and multiple great takes of each line. When it involves manufacturing, toenailing your shots is key. You don't wish to be stuck having to reshoot due to the fact that you really did not obtain sufficient good takes of each line.


As a director, Chris suches as to obtain at the very least 2 really good takes of every line prior to going into the edit. When we serviced the Welcome to Wistia project, we alloted three days for production, but only 2 for really shooting around the office. Why two days, you ask? Well, our workplace had not been exactly camera-ready.


You merely could not regurgitate an electronic camera and begin capturing. Remember, we wanted our videos to be shiny, so we had to be incredibly willful with our collection design, props, lighting, and every little thing that comprised the shot. Offering on your own enough time throughout production is critical to ensuring your shots are area on.
